OnePlus 10T vs. Asus Zenfone 11 Ultra: A Deep Dive

Let's dissect the OnePlus 10T and the Asus Zenfone 11 Ultra, two compelling smartphones with distinct strengths. We'll go beyond the spec sheet to uncover what these differences truly mean for you.

2. Key Insights

The OnePlus 10T prioritizes raw speed and fast charging. Its Snapdragon 8+ Gen 1, while a generation older, still delivers excellent performance. The 150W charging is a standout feature, topping up the battery incredibly quickly. However, it lacks a dedicated telephoto lens.

The Asus Zenfone 11 Ultra represents a more well-rounded flagship. Its newer Snapdragon 8 Gen 3, superior GPU, higher refresh rate display, larger battery, and versatile camera system make it a powerhouse. While its 65W charging is slower than the 10T's, it's still respectably fast.

3. User Profiles and Recommendations

OnePlus 10T: Ideal for users who value speed and fast charging above all else. Gamers on a budget and those constantly on the go will appreciate its performance and rapid charging capabilities.

Asus Zenfone 11 Ultra: Suited for users seeking a premium, feature-rich experience. Content creators, mobile photographers, and power users who demand the latest and greatest will find the Zenfone 11 Ultra compelling.

4. Buying Decision Framework

  • Is blazing-fast charging your top priority? If so, the OnePlus 10T is the clear winner.
  • Do you need the best possible camera system and overall performance? The Zenfone 11 Ultra excels in these areas.
  • What's your budget? The OnePlus 10T generally offers better value for its price, while the Zenfone 11 Ultra commands a premium for its advanced features.
